Abstract

The invention discloses an ecological and environment-friendly type mixed feed for a pike and a preparation method of the ecological and environment-friendly type mixed feed. The mixed feed is prepared from the following raw materials: puffed soybean meal, puffed soybean meal, fermented soybean meal, steamed fish meal, chicken meal, peanut meal, cottonseed meal, double-low rapeseed meal, corn germ meal, rice bran, flour, soybean oil, soya bean lecithin, deep sea fish oil, zeolite powder, monocalcium phosphate, choline chloride, L-ascorbic acid-2-phosphate, table salt, complex vitamin, complex trace element, glycine betaine, bacillus subtilis, yeast cell wall polysaccharide, high-temperature resistant phytase, allicin and citric acid. The feed can meet all demands of the pike to nutrition, is high in feed conversion rate, has the food coefficient ranging from 1.5 to 1.9, improves the water environment, reduces 30 to 50% of emitted ammonia nitrogen in the water mass, remarkably improves the immunity of the pike, brings high activity to the pike, increases 5 to 10% of the survival rate, and obviously increases the economic benefit.

Description

Ecological environment-friendly type mullet mixed feed and preparation method thereof
Technical field
The present invention relates to aquatic feeds, be specifically related to a kind of ecological environment-friendly type mullet mixed feed and preparation method thereof.
Background technology
Mullet, i.e. Mullet fish, belongs to the Mugilidae of Mugiliformes, the feeding habits of mullet are very wide, belong to take plant feed as main ominivore-fish, be deposited on the benthic diatom on bed mud surface and organic debris as main to scrape food, also eat some thread algae, general sufficient class, Polychaeta, software class and small-sized shrimps etc.Ingest as rice bran, beancake powder, groundnut meal, solid carbon dioxide flea and artifical compound feed etc. propagating under condition also happiness artificially.Mullet has abundant nutrition, Fresh & Tender in Texture, tasty, and protein content is very high, is the delicacies in feast.
Existing mullet feed, simply combines with single raw material or several raw material, and nutrition is comprehensive not, and efficiency of feed utilization is low, to severe water pollution, can not meet the nutritional need of mullet growth, and economic benefit is low, has wretched insufficiency.
Summary of the invention
Technical problem to be solved by this invention is to provide a kind of ecological environment-friendly type mullet mixed feed, overcomes the incomplete problem of existing mullet feed nutrition, and solves the pollution problem to water environment.
The present invention is achieved through the following technical solutions:
Ecological environment-friendly type mullet mixed feed, component by following weight portion is formulated, swelling soya dreg 160-200 part, soy bean powder 38-42 part, fermented bean dregs 29-31 part, steam fish meal 49-51 part, chicken meal 19-21 part, peanut meal 27-29 part, Cottonseed Meal 128-132 part, double lower rapeseed dreg 202-218 part, corn germ cake 64-66 part, rice bran 79-81 part, flour 89-91 part, soya-bean oil 14-16 part, 8 parts of soybean lecithins, 5 parts of deep sea fish oils, 20 parts of zeolite powders, 15 parts of calcium dihydrogen phosphates, 2 parts of the Choline Chlorides of mass concentration 60%, L-AA-2-phosphoesterase 30 of mass concentration 35%. 4 parts, 2 parts of salt, 1 part of B B-complex for fish, 3 parts of composite trace elements for fish, 2 parts of the betaines of mass concentration 30%, 10000000000/gram 0. 15 parts of bacillus subtilises, 1 part of yeast cell wall polysaccharide, 0.15 part of the high temperature resistant phytase of 5000 U/g, 0.3 part of the allicin of mass concentration 25%, 2 parts of citric acids.
The further improvement project of the present invention is, every 100 grams of the ammonia absorption value of described zeolite powder is greater than 0.16 mole, and the fineness of zeolite powder is greater than 100 orders.
The present invention further improvement project is that described fish contains vitamin A 8,000 ten thousand IU, neo dohyfral D3 1,500 ten thousand IU, vitamin E 80g, prokeyvit with every kilogram of B B-complex ?9.5g, pangamic acid .5g, vitamin B2 ?12.5g, vitamin B6 10g, cobalamin 2g, nicotinic acid 42g, pantothenic acid 28g, folic acid 1.5g, inositol 80g.
The present invention more further improvement project be, every kilogram of iron content 50g of composite trace element, copper 1g, zinc 40g, manganese 10g, iodine 0.4g, selenium 0.08g, cobalt 0.2 g, magnesium 80g for described fish.
The present invention more further improvement project be, described yeast cell wall polysaccharide is greater than 20% containing mannosan, containing β-1,3/1,6-glucan is greater than 20%.
The preparation method of ecological environment-friendly type mullet mixed feed, is characterized in that: comprises the following steps, and by parts by weight of component claimed in claim 1,
(1) by calcium dihydrogen phosphate, Choline Chloride, L-AA-2-phosphate, salt, B B-complex for fish, for fish, composite trace element, betaine, bacillus subtilis, yeast cell wall polysaccharide, high temperature resistant phytase, allicin, citric acid are pre-blended into additive semi-finished product for standby;
(2) swelling soya dreg, soy bean powder, fermented bean dregs, steam fish meal, chicken meal, peanut meal, Cottonseed Meal, double lower rapeseed dreg, corn germ cake, rice bran are pulverized; then the additive semi-finished product that add step (1) to obtain; finally add again flour flour, soya-bean oil, soybean lecithin, deep sea fish oil, zeolite powder; mix, modified slaking, granulation, cooling; use again crushed machine fragmentation; sieve with classifying screen; upper sieve is that 10 orders, lower screen are 12 orders, gets the particulate feed between two layer screen.
The further improvement project of the present invention is that in step (2), pulverizing sieve aperture used is 0.1-1.0mm.
The present invention further improvement project is, the incorporation time in step (2) is about 160 seconds, and the mixture homogeneity coefficient of variation is less than 7%.
The present invention further improvement project is, the modified curing time in step (2) is about 60 seconds, and the temperature after modified is 90-95 ℃.
The present invention further improvement project is that in step (2), the difference of cooling later material temperature and room temperature is not higher than 5 ℃.
The invention has the beneficial effects as follows: this Feed Energy meets whole nutritional needs of mullet, feed conversion rate is high, feed coefficient is between 1.5-1.9, can improve water environment, reduce the ammonia nitrogen discharge 30-50% in water body, use this feed can obviously improve the body immunity of mullet, fish vitality of subject is good, survival rate improves 5-10%, and economic benefit obviously improves.

For the result of use of checking the present invention to mullet, applicant has carried out ecological environment-friendly type mullet mixed feed culture experiment in certain culture experiment field;
Table 1 is common mullet feed and the impact of ecological environment-friendly type mullet mixed feed on ammonia nitrogen in water body.
Fish pond numbering 10 days ammonia nitrogen concentrations 20 days ammonia nitrogen concentrations 30 days ammonia nitrogen concentrations 40 days ammonia nitrogen concentrations 50 days ammonia nitrogen concentrations
0.28 0.30 0.31 0.30 0.32
0.26 0.28 0.30 0.31 0.30
0.25 0.22 0.18 0.19 0.17
0.29 0.24 0.21 0.18 0.16
I, II are control group, select common mullet feed, and two groups of III, IV are test group, select a kind of ecological environment-friendly type mullet mixed feed of the present invention.As seen from Table 1, III, IV group ammonia-nitrogen content are starkly lower than control group, and along with the prolongation of service time is on a declining curve; Analyzing reason is mainly in feed of the present invention, to have used bacillus subtilis, zeolite powder, and wherein bacillus subtilis can be decomposed residual bait in water body, ight soil, dead algae etc., safeguards water quality, reduces disease; The duct of zeolite powder is of a size of 4.2 nanometers, hole and duct account for the 40-50% of cumulative volume, form very large internal surface area, the internal surface area of every gram of this zeolite reaches more than 1000 square metre, adsorbable and store a large amount of lewis' acids, ammonia, hydrogen sulfide, carbon dioxide isopolarity molecule in can adsorbed water body, improve water body environment greatly.
Below the impact of ecological environment-friendly type mullet mixed feed on mullet growth performance: by mullet culture experiment, research and observe feed of the present invention to the ingesting and the impact of growth result of mullet, verifies the result of use of this invention.
1.1 experimental animals and grouping: experimental animal is 20 grams/fish of mullet fingerlings, derive from Lianyun Harbour one fish seeding ground, supports 2 weeks temporarily; Before test, select the mullet of physique stalwartness, neat specification, divide at random 4 groups, be respectively control group, 1 group of experiment, 2 groups of experiments, 3 groups of experiments, establish 3 repetitions for every group, totally 12 breeding barrels (breeding barrel specification is diameter 70cm, and height is 100cm), each breeding barrel 20 tail mullets.
1.2 test daily rations: test daily ration is the feed of embodiment 1-3.
1.3 feedings and managements: test site is plant of company indoor laboratory, test adopts microcirculation to change water, clearance-type oxygenation; Water temperature is controlled at 22~25 ℃; Every day, daily ration of feeding was 2.5~4% of fish body weight 9:00,13:00 and 18:00 bait throwing in 3 times; The formal test phase is on June 21,21 days to 2012 April in 2012, totally 60 days.
1.4 sample collections and analysis:
Rate of body weight gain (%)=(finishing counterpoise-initial counterpoise)/initial counterpoise × 100
Specific growth rate (%/d)=(finish counterpoise-initial counterpoise) ∕ and raise number of days * 100
Feed coefficient=Zong Chong Liang ∕ fish body total augment weight feeds intake
1.5 data processings: use EXCEL record data, SPSS17.0 carries out data statistic analysis, significance test adopts One-Way ANOVA method, carries out multiple ratio by Duncan method, and data are expressed as mean value plus-minus standard error (Means ± SEM).
Ecological environment-friendly type mullet mixed feed on the impact of mullet rate of body weight gain and feed coefficient from table 2, the rate of body weight gain of experimental group and control group significant difference (P<0.05); The 3rd group of rate of body weight gain maximum, with other each group significant differences (P<0.05); For specific growth rate, the 1st group, the 2nd group, the 3rd group and control group significant difference (P<0.05), the 3rd group of grass carp specific growth rate is the highest, with other each group significant differences; Can find out from rate of body weight gain and specific growth rate, ecological environment-friendly type mullet mixed feed can promote the growth of mullet.
the impact of table 2 mixed feed on mullet rate of body weight gain and feed coefficient
Process Control group Test 1 group Test 2 groups Test 3 groups
Just counterpoise (g) 12.05±0.34 11.89±0.92 13.45±1.05 12.97±0.91
Finish counterpoise (g) 25.69±3.67 26.64±3.28 30.91±2.41 30.54±2.88
Rate of body weight gain (%) 113.23±0.96 a 124.02±2.50 b 129.79±1.40 c 135.47±1.25 d
Specific growth rate (%) 1.26±0.02 a 1.34±0.00 b 1.38±0.01 c 1.43±0.01 d
Ecological environment-friendly type mullet mixed feed on the impact of mullet feed coefficient as can be seen from Table 3, the 1st group, the 2nd group, the 3rd group with control group significant difference different significantly (P<0.05); The 3rd group of feed coefficient is minimum, and control group feed coefficient is the highest; The 1st group, the 2nd group, the 3rd group not remarkable (P>0.05) of group difference.
table 3 is tested the impact of each group of feed coefficient
Process Control group Test 1 group Test 2 groups Test 3 groups
Feed coefficient 2.05±0.03 b 1.81±0.06 a 1.79±0.07 a 1.72±0.05 a
Can find out from table 2, table 3, it is obvious that ecological environment-friendly type mullet mixed feed improves the production performance of mullet, analysis main cause is: this invention protein raw materials swelling soya dreg, soy bean powder, fermented bean dregs, inlet steam fish meal, chicken meal, peanut meal, Cottonseed Meal, double lower rapeseed dreg animal/vegetable protein collocation adequate nutrition balance, in fermented bean dregs, high molecular weight protein is degraded into small molecular protein, and contain little peptide components, be easy to digest and assimilate; Selected energy feedstuff soya-bean oil, soybean lecithin, the different grease combinations of deep sea fish oil, rationally, soybean lecithin has the effect of emulsified fat, has improved the utilization rate of energy for saturated fatty acid and the collocation of unsaturated not aliphatic acid; Selected additive raw material yeast cell wall polysaccharide, 25% allicin can increase the immunity of mullet, guarantee fish body health, prevent disease, thus improve the production performance of mullet.
